
Condor Energies Inc. faced a notable decline in its stock price during yesterday's trading session.
Condor Energies Inc. (CDR.TO) saw its stock price drop by 3.68% yesterday, closing at CA$4.45. This decline comes as the market closely watches the energy sector's performance, especially with fluctuating oil prices and shifting investor sentiment.

Condor Energies Inc. closed at CA$4.45 after a 3.68% drop in stock price during yesterday's trading session. Investors reacted to the company's recent announcements and the overall market sentiment, which has been cautious due to fluctuating energy prices.
Financial Health Concerns
With a market cap of approximately CA$384 million and a troubling profit margin of -9.48%, investors are left questioning the sustainability of Condor Energies Inc.'s business model. The recent public offering of CA$15 million may provide some liquidity, but it also raises concerns about the company's financial strategy.
Looking Ahead
As Condor Energies Inc. navigates these challenges, investors should keep an eye on upcoming earnings reports and market conditions. The company's ability to turn around its financial performance will be crucial for regaining investor confidence.
